the average height of the girls is 135.
the average height of the boys is 150.
the average height of the boys and the girls together is 138.


let x = number of girls.
let y = number of boys.
then x+y = number of girls and boys together.


the total number of girls is equal to 135 * x
the total number of boys is equal to 150 * y
the total number of boys and girls together is equal to 138 * (x + y)


you get an equation that says:


135 * x + 150 * y = 138 * (x + y)


simplify to get:


135 * x + 150 * y = 138 * x + 138 * y


subtract 135 * x from both sides of the equation and subtract 138 * y from both sides of the equation to get:


150 * y - 138 * y = 138 * x - 135 * x


combine like terms to get:


12 * y = 3 * x


divide both sides of the equation by x and divide both sides of the equation by 12 and you get:


y/x = 3/12


this equation says that the ratio of boys to girls is equal to 3/12.


this equation also says:


the ratio of boys to total = 3 / (12 + 3) = 3/15.


the ratio of girls to boys is equal to 12/3.


the ratio of girls to total is 12/ (3 + 12) = 12/15.


the fraction of girls to total number of children together is the same as the ratio of girls to total which is equal to 12/15.


is this accurate?


let's see.


assume the number of children is equal to 15.


12 are girls.
3 are boys.


total score for girls is 135 * 12
total score for boys is 150 * 3.
total score overall is 138  * 15.


if 135 * 12 + 150 * 3 = 138 * 15, then the solution is good.


we get:


1620 + 450 = 2070


simplify this to get 2070 = 2070


this confirms that the ratio of girls to total and the ratio of boys to total is good which confirms that the fraction of the children that are girls is also good and is 12/15 which can be simplified to 4/5.
